Welcome to Warwick — the historic county town of Warwickshire, where medieval walls meet Georgian streets and the castle looms majestically over everything (including the parking situation). With around 35,000 residents who know every shortcut to the A46, Warwick blends heritage charm with modern convenience.
Schools That Actually Impress
Warwick School, King’s High School for Girls, Myton School, and Aylesford School all carry strong reputations. Add in excellent primaries and nearby independent options, and you’ve got plenty of choice — plus parents comparing grades over coffee on Smith Street.
Economy With a Balance
Warwick’s economy is powered by local government, tourism, hospitality, and a strong professional sector, with many residents commuting to Leamington, Coventry, and Birmingham. With quick access to the M40 and A46, it’s a town that’s historic, connected, and quietly thriving.
Things to Do (Besides Counting Turrets)
Warwick Castle – jousting, dungeons, birds of prey, and enough history to fill a weekend.
St Nicholas Park – riverside walks, playgrounds, and a perfect family day out.
Local favourites – Market Hall Museum, canal strolls, and independent cafés tucked down side streets.
